Suzuki Motor Corp notches highest-ever overseas production in January
Of SMC's total overseas production of 202,902 units in January, Maruti Suzuki India contributed 153,262 units or 75 percent.
Suzuki Motor Corp (SMC), which released preliminary numbers for automobile production in January 2017,has hit record manufacturing levels.
In Japan, production volume increased for the first time in 23 months due to an increase in production for both the domestic market as well as exports.
Overseas production volume at 202,902 units (+114.6%) recorded the highest ever monthly volume as a result of growing consumer demand in various markets including India and Thailand. Maruti Suzuki India manufactured a total of 153,362 units (+32.46% YoY) in January, which constitutes an overwhelming 75.58% of SMC's total overseas production volume.
As a result, SMC’s cumulative global production volume became the highest ever for January due to an increase in both Japan and overseas production.
